  • Embedding an AES signal in the SDI using Multibridge Extreme

    Posted by Earthworm on February 17, 2007 at 1:02 am

    I just can’t get the AES embedded. I’ve used two different 25pin AES breakout cable (including a brand new one custom made to the Multibridge specs) I have no problems with the SDI with embedded audio, including when passing through the Multibridge. I’ve checking everything on the deck side, it is sending the signal and it is passing through the cables.

    The Multibridge analog audio out (which I use for monitoring only) still passes the (original) SDI embedded audio.

    When I try to capture setting the AES inputs to embed into the SDI signal I just get no audio signal (not even the original embedded).

    Anything else I can try? Am I missing a setting somewhere?

    Using: Decklink HD Pro PCIe and Multibridge Extreme in a Quad G5 running FCP 5.1.2. Multibridge and Decklink software is up-to-date.
